What To Look For In An Ergonomic Office Chair: A Step-By-Step Guide
Step 1: Adjustable Seat Height
Look for a chair that allows you to adjust the height of the seat so that your feet are flat on the ground and your knees are at a 90-degree angle. This helps to promote good posture and reduce pressure on your lower back.
Step 2: Lumbar Support
Choose a chair with built-in lumbar support that fits the natural curve of your spine. This helps to reduce strain on your lower back and prevent slouching.
Step 3: Adjustable Armrests
Make sure the armrests are adjustable so that your arms are at a comfortable height and angle when typing or using the mouse. This helps to prevent shoulder and neck pain.
Step 4: Swivel Base
A swivel base allows you to easily turn and reach different areas of your desk without straining your back or neck.
Step 5: Breathable Fabric
Look for a chair with breathable fabric to prevent overheating and discomfort during long periods of sitting.

Question & Answer and FAQs
Q: How much should I expect to spend on an ergonomic office chair?
A: Prices can vary widely depending on the brand and features of the chair. However, a high-quality ergonomic office chair typically costs between $200-$500.
Q: Can an ergonomic office chair prevent long-term health problems?
A: Yes, an ergonomic office chair can help prevent long-term health problems such as back pain, neck pain, and carpal tunnel syndrome.
Q: Do all ergonomic office chairs come with a headrest?
A: No, not all ergonomic office chairs come with a headrest. However, a headrest can be a helpful feature for those who experience neck pain or tension headaches.
